Devil Gulch in California is a hidden gem that's quite challenging to access. The trail leading to the waterfall is tricky, but those who make the effort are rewarded with an incredible view. Despite its difficulty, the seclusion adds to the allure and makes the experience feel exclusive. This well-kept secret is perfect for adventurous hikers seeking a unique and rewarding journey.

As amenities may be minimal near the site, it's wise to pack essentials like water, snacks, and weather-appropriate clothing. Check local weather and trail conditions before setting out.
Utilizing a GPS or a detailed local map is recommended, as signage in more remote areas can be limited. Apps like Google Maps or specialized hiking trail apps can be useful to ensure you're on the right path.
As with any natural site, practice Leave No Trace principles. This helps preserve the pristine condition of Devil Gulch for future visitors and protects the local ecosystem.
